Prep and Cook Time

  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 20 minutes
  • Total Time: 30 minutes

yield

Serves 4

Difficulty Level

Easy

Ingredients

  • 1 lb (450g) new potatoes, thoroughly washed and halved if large
  • 3 tbsp unsalted butter
  • 2 tbsp fresh mint leaves, finely chopped
  • Sea sal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ste
  • 1 clove garlic, lightly crushed (optional)
  • Fresh parsley for garnish (optional)

Instructions

  1.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add the new potatoes and cook over medium heat until just tender when pierced with a fork, about 12-15 minutes depending on size.
  2. While the potatoes cook, gently melt the butter in a small saucepan over low heat with the crushed garlic clove. This will infuse the butter with a subtle aromatic depth. Remove garlic after 3 minutes to avoid bitterness.
  3. Drain potatoes thoroughly, allowing them to steam dry in the colander for 2-3 minutes. This prevents watery butter from diluting the flavor.
  4. Transfer the potatoes to a warmed serving bowl.Pour the melted butter evenly over the potatoes, tossing gently to coat without breaking their skins.
  5. Sprinkle the fresh mint and a pinch of sea salt and black pepper over the potatoes. Toss again until the herbs are evenly distributed.
  6. Garnish with additional fresh parsley leaves for a vibrant pop of color and aroma.
  7. serve immediately alongside your preferred English main dishes such as roast lamb or grilled sausages.

Tips for Success

  • For the freshest flavor,pick mint leaves from your garden or buy locally sourced mint if possible. Dried mint can be used but will lack the radiant,refreshing note.
  • If you want a richer taste, substitute half the butter with a knob of goose fat – a classic English kitchen secret.
  • Cook potatoes with their skins on to keep them intact and add a pleasing texture; peeling is optional but not traditional.
  • To make this dish ahead, cook and toss the potatoes in butter and mint, then chill. Reheat gently in a pan with a splash of water or butter to revive the softness without drying them.

Q&A

Q&A: Savor England – A Guide to Classic English Side Dishes

Q1: What makes English side dishes stand out in traditional meals?
A1: English side dishes are more than mere accompaniments-they’re flavor traditions steeped in history. From buttery mashed potatoes to crispy Yorkshire puddings, these sides complement hearty main courses while carrying a comforting, rustic charm. Their simplicity and emphasis on fresh, local ingredients create a nostalgic taste that perfectly balances English cuisine.

Q2: Which side dish is considered quintessentially English and why?
A2: Yorkshire pudding holds the crown as quintessentially English. Originally created to make use of beef drippings, this light and airy batter puff rises golden and crisp in the oven. It’s a beloved staple, especially alongside Sunday roast dinners, embodying the spirit of English home cooking.

Q3: Are there any classic vegetable sides quintessential to English meals?
A3: Absolutely! Minted peas,mushy peas,and buttered carrots regularly grace English dining tables. Peas, frequently enough simply cooked and seasoned with fresh mint or butter, bring a bright, fresh note, while mushy peas offer a creamy, comforting texture. These vegetable sides celebrate seasonal freshness, adding color and balance.

Q4: How do English side dishes reflect regional diversity?
A4: england’s regions boast unique twists on classic sides. As an example, bubble and squeak-pan-fried mash and cabbage-originated in Yorkshire but enjoyed nationwide. Cornish pasties accompany manny Cornish dinners, while Lancashire hotpot might be paired with tatties (potatoes) cooked in various delightful ways.This regional flair highlights local produce and culinary customs.

Q5: What role do breads and pastries play as English side dishes?
A5: Breads and pastries, like crusty bread rolls or flaky pork pies, often take on the role of sides, offering texture contrast and rustic heartiness. Crumpets and buttered scones may appear alongside breakfast or tea, reinforcing the integral role of baked goods within English culinary identity.

Q6: Can classic English sides cater to modern dietary preferences?
A6: Certainly! Many traditional sides, like roasted root vegetables or mashed potatoes made with plant-based butter, adapt easily for vegan or gluten-free diets. Mushy peas are naturally vegan, and Yorkshire pudding recipes can be tweaked to accommodate dietary needs while preserving their distinctive character.

Q7: What are some tips for pairing these sides with English main courses?
A7: Balance is key.Rich meats, such as roast beef or lamb, suit creamy mashed potatoes and savoury Yorkshire puddings. lighter mains like grilled fish harmonize beautifully with minted peas and buttered new potatoes, providing refreshing contrasts. When in doubt,think texture and seasoning-creamy sides soften,crisp ones add crunch.
